Something from this tree breaks my i965.
Using -git just before this was pulled,

 a552f0af753eb4b5bbbe9eff205fe874b04c4583 works, but using latest git

makes google earth stall, it doesn't update its main window. It appears
that openining and closing its menu, allows it to progress frame after
frame. No crashes hangs however.

Used latest -git of all graphic components (mesa, libdrm, xserver, intel
driver)

KMS is used, as well as UXA and DRI2 (this is enabled by default now)


Compiz used as well, but this happens without it as well.
